What is Modular Synthesis Software?

Modular synthesis software replicates the functionality of physical modular synthesizers within a digital environment. Users connect virtual modules—such as oscillators, filters, envelopes, and sequencers—using virtual patch cables. This intuitive, visual patching process forms signal paths that generate and sculpt sound.

Each module performs a specific function, and their interconnection defines the overall sound and behavior of the synthetic instrument. This paradigm fosters a deep understanding of sound design principles and encourages creative problem-solving. Exploring modular synthesis software reveals a universe of sonic potential.

Why Choose Software Over Hardware?

Opting for modular synthesis software offers several compelling advantages over its hardware counterpart. These benefits make it an attractive entry point for newcomers and a powerful tool for experienced synthesists alike.

  • Cost-Effectiveness: Hardware modular systems can be prohibitively expensive, with individual modules costing hundreds or thousands of dollars. Modular synthesis software often comes at a fraction of the price, with many excellent free options available.

  • Unlimited Modules: Software environments typically allow for an almost infinite number of modules within a single patch, limited only by your computer’s processing power. This eliminates the physical space and power supply constraints of hardware.

  • Portability and Recall: Software patches can be saved, recalled, and shared instantly, making it easy to continue projects across different locations. Hardware setups require physical re-patching for each new configuration.

  • Flexibility and Experimentation: The ease of virtual patching encourages bold experimentation without the risk of damaging expensive hardware. Undo functions and rapid module swapping enhance the creative workflow.

Key Features to Look For

When selecting modular synthesis software, several features contribute significantly to the user experience and creative potential. Understanding these aspects helps in choosing the right platform for your needs.

Extensive Module Library

A rich and diverse collection of modules is crucial for creative depth. Look for software that offers a wide array of:

  • Oscillators: Various waveforms, wavetable, and granular options.

  • Filters: Low-pass, high-pass, band-pass, and unique filter types.

  • Envelope Generators: ADSR, AHDSR, and looping envelopes.

  • LFOs and Modulators: Complex modulation sources for dynamic sound.

  • Sequencers and Utilities: For rhythmic patterns, logic, and signal processing.

Intuitive Patching Interface

The ease of connecting modules directly impacts your workflow. A clean, responsive interface with clear visual cues for signal flow is paramount. Drag-and-drop functionality and color-coded cables enhance usability.

Performance and Stability

Modular synthesis can be CPU-intensive, especially with complex patches. Ensure the software runs stably on your system and efficiently manages resources. Low latency is also critical for real-time performance and playability.

Integration with Digital Audio Workstations (DAWs)

Many modular synthesis software solutions offer VST/AU plugin versions, allowing seamless integration into your existing DAW. This enables you to incorporate modular sounds directly into your productions, alongside other instruments and effects.

Popular Modular Synthesis Software Options

Several excellent modular synthesis software platforms are available, each with its unique strengths and community. Exploring these options can help you find the perfect fit for your sound design journey.

VCV Rack

VCV Rack is a prominent open-source virtual modular synthesizer. It offers an extensive library of free modules, with many commercial modules also available from third-party developers. Its active community and strong feature set make it an incredibly popular choice for exploring modular synthesis software.

Softube Modular

Softube Modular provides a highly authentic emulation of classic hardware modular systems. It’s known for its high-fidelity sound and detailed module emulations, including licensed modules from renowned manufacturers. This software offers a premium experience for those seeking realism.

Native Instruments Reaktor Blocks

Reaktor Blocks is a powerful semi-modular environment within Native Instruments’ Reaktor platform. It allows users to build custom synthesizers, effects, and sequencers from a vast collection of blocks. Reaktor’s flexibility extends beyond modular synthesis, offering a complete sound design toolkit.

Cherry Audio Voltage Modular

Voltage Modular by Cherry Audio is celebrated for its user-friendly interface and robust module library. It boasts excellent performance and a growing ecosystem of both free and commercial modules. Its approachable design makes it a great starting point for beginners in modular synthesis software.

Tips for Effective Patching

Mastering modular synthesis software takes time, but these tips can accelerate your learning and improve your sound design.

  • Start Simple: Begin with a basic oscillator, filter, and envelope patch before adding complexity. This builds a strong foundation.

  • Listen Critically: Pay close attention to how each connection changes the sound. Develop your ear for subtle nuances.

  • Document Your Patches: Take notes or screenshots of interesting patches. This helps you recreate or evolve your favorite sounds.

  • Embrace Modulation: Use LFOs, envelopes, and other control voltage sources to add movement and life to your patches. Dynamic sounds are often more engaging.

  • Utilize Effects: Don’t forget to incorporate virtual effects like delay, reverb, and distortion to enhance your modular creations.
